What Actually Fills Steins Gutters

In Garden City the gutter problem is grit, not leaves. Asphalt shingles shed granules for the life of a roof and they wash straight into the trough, and river-bottom damp that keeps north elevations from drying, plus traffic film off Chinden Boulevard and State Street adds a fine silt on top. Together they make a dense sludge that sits in the low end of the run and does not flush. Where there are mature trees, seed pods and catkins pack the downspout outlets on top of that. We hand-clear the trough rather than blowing it, bag the debris, then flush every downspout and confirm it runs. We see it most consistently on the homes along N Bogart Ln.

Downspouts Are Where It Actually Fails

A gutter full of grit still mostly works. A plugged downspout does not — it backs water up the trough, over the front lip and down the fascia, and that is where damage starts. We flush every downspout and watch it discharge; if one will not clear we tell you where the blockage is rather than declaring the job done. The fall pass is the one that matters for ice: a trough packed with wet grit freezes solid, and an ice dam pushes meltwater back under the shingle edge. Why would my gutters clog when my trees are small?

Shingle granules and irrigation silt, not leaves. Every asphalt roof sheds grit continuously, and here it mixes with mineral and field dust into a heavy sludge. Newer neighborhoods clog as reliably as old ones — the material is just different.

Do you get on the roof?

Only where the pitch and condition make it safe and it is genuinely needed. Most gutters we clear from ladders, which is safer for us and easier on your shingles.

Do you clean up the debris?

Yes. It is bagged and hauled, not blown into the beds, and we rinse any spatter off the siding and walks before we leave.
